- Medina of Tunis - This expansive maze of ancient streets and alleys stands as one of the most remarkable medieval medinas in North Africa and is among Tunisia’s prized treasures. It hosts numerous covered souks offering everything from shoes to shisha, alongside lively cafes, alleyways bustling with artisans, and residential areas highlighted by large, vibrantly painted doorways. Historic palaces, hammams, mosques, and madrassas (schools for studying the Koran) are scattered throughout, many adorned with intricate tiles, carved stucco, and marble columns.
- La Goulette - This suburban district is famous for its constant lively atmosphere that fills the streets all year long. The terraces of cafes and restaurants line up along the sea.
- Site Archeologique de Carthage - The archaeological site of Carthage is dispersed throughout the modern city of Carthage (Tunisia) and has been recognized as a UNESCO World Heritage Site since 1979.
- Sidi Bou Said - Known for its unique blue and white colors, cobbled streets, and stunning views of azure waters, the cliff-top village of Sidi Bou Said is one of Tunisia’s most picturesque locations. Its distinctive architecture blends Ottoman and Andalusian styles, a result of the Spanish Muslim influx in the 16th century.
- The National Bardo Museum - Situated in Tunis, the Bardo Museum boasts one of the world’s richest collections of Roman mosaics, chronicling Tunisia’s history from prehistoric times to the present day.
